Middleton Place: America's Oldest Landscaped Gardens & Plantation House
3culture

Middleton Place: America's Oldest Landscaped Gardens & Plantation House

Wander 300-year-old terraced butterfly lakes, medieval-style gardens, and a surviving plantation house that witnessed every chapter of American history — from colonial splendor through the Civil War. Middleton Place is living history on an almost cinematic scale.

Book it withMiddleton Place (Official)USD 29 gardens admission; USD 15 add-on for House Museum guided tour; stable-yards included

Magnolia Plantation: Gothic Gardens, Canoe Trail & Nature Boat Tour
4wildlife

Magnolia Plantation: Gothic Gardens, Canoe Trail & Nature Boat Tour

America's oldest public garden (open since 1870) pairs romantic antebellum grounds with a wild 125-acre waterfowl refuge and an intimate Nature Boat Tour through blackwater cypress swamps alive with alligators, herons, and turtles.

Book it withMagnolia Plantation & Gardens (Official)USD 25 general admission + USD 8 Nature Boat Tour add-on; Audubon Swamp canoe rental from USD 10/person

Boone Hall Plantation: Gullah Heritage Tour & Avenue of Oaks
5culture

Boone Hall Plantation: Gullah Heritage Tour & Avenue of Oaks

Drive the most photographed live-oak avenue in America, then join an intimate Gullah-Geechee cultural program — one of the most powerful and authentic African-American heritage experiences in the South. This is history that demands to be heard.

Book it withBoone Hall Plantation & Gardens (Official)USD 28 adults general admission; guided Gullah experience included with admission

Folly Beach Eco Boat: Dolphin Watch, Morris Island & Wild Coast
6water

Folly Beach Eco Boat: Dolphin Watch, Morris Island & Wild Coast

Board a small-group eco-vessel for a wild ride through Folly Beach's pristine salt marshes, with a dropoff on remote Morris Island to explore a 19th-century lighthouse ruin — then watch wild bottlenose dolphins surf your wake home.

Book it withBarrier Island Eco Tours (Official)USD 45–USD 55 per adult (small-group eco tour with Morris Island access)
